Massive AI factory in Makarewa to be second-largest electricity user

A large AI factory, projected to open in Makarewa in 2028, is anticipated to be the second-largest consumer of electricity in the region. This facility's significant energy demands have raised concerns, particularly from engineers and critics who view the development as a speculative venture driven by financial interests rather than genuine technological advancement.
